Wanna test drive Nokia N8 or C7? Here’s your chance!

8 Oct

Are you not convinced by N8 and Symbian^3 yet? You’re wondering how the things works and looks exactly? Maybe you have a one, particular app that you can’t live without and you are worried if it’s working on newer OS? Well, I think I have a solution for you.

Forum Nokia have a special developer tool for testing their apps on real devices, connected to the servers somewhere in Finland. Thankfully you don’t have to be a developer to test out those devices. All you need to have is a Java installed on your computer and a Forum Nokia account. Once you register and login to your account go to Remote Device Access page. There you have a list of devices you can test right now. There are 3 C7s and 7 N8s available at the moment. Not only the newest ones but also older S60v3 and S60v5 devices. There are also some limitations. You have 8 hours per day for reservations and you can reserve each device for max. 3 hours. Don’t worry if all devices are in use at the moment. You can schedule your reservation for sometime in the near future. By the time you’re waiting for your turn you can collect all the software that you want to test on the device etc. You have the option to browse all the disks, install the new software, upload files into the phone’s memory and download files from it. But be nice and don’t mess it up, when you finish testing – remember to uninstall the apps that you installed etc. Just keep it clean. If there’s a time left – and you already finished your testing – cancel the reservation to make it accessible for others. Keep in mind that this a tool for developers. Don’t overuse it just for fun because Nokia can decide to pull it down due to the unwanted traffic.


Ultimate camera smackdown! Is E5′s EDOF camera that bad?

6 Oct

There was a lot of buzz recently about Nokia’s new strategy on middle-end phone’s cameras. I’m talking about EDoF. Some of you might not be familiar with this abbreviation so I’m here to help. Basically, without going techie on this one, it means that the camera module can’t focus on a one, particular object. The camera is able to focus on all the things that are in the distance from 50cm to infinity. It means that you can say ‘bye bye’ to all those stunning close-ups and macros that you took before with your smartphone.

Unfortunately it looks like whole new Eseries line-up is going to go EDoF and leave the Auto-Focus equipped cameras to multimedia centered Nseries. Today, I’m going to compare Nokia E5′s 5mpix camera with 6700 slide (5mpix Carl Zeiss) and E71 (3,2mpix AF). I tried to took pics in several different light conditions and distances (low light, daylight, close-up’s and normal pics). Nokia E5 review

2 Oct

Overview

Nokia E5 is one of the latest Eseries devices that are now available on the market. It’s S60 3rd edition Feature Pack 2 device. It has full range of connectivity options: 3G, HSUPA,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th and  GPS (with aGPS). 5 mpix camera with LED flash, qwerty keyboard, 2,36” LCD display and so on.
